General annotation (Comments)
| Function | The B regulatory subunit might modulate substrate selectivity and catalytic activity, and also might direct the localization of the catalytic enzyme to a particular subcellular compartment. |
| Subunit structure | PP2A consists of a common heterodimeric core enzyme, composed of a 36 kDa catalytic subunit (subunit C) and a 65 kDa constant regulatory subunit (PR65 or subunit A), that associates with a variety of regulatory subunits. Proteins that associate with the core dimer include three families of regulatory subunits B (the R2/B/PR55/B55, R3/B''/PR72/PR130/PR59 and R5/B'/B56 families), the 48 kDa variable regulatory subunit, viral proteins, and cell signaling molecules. Interacts with SGOL1. Ref.9 |
| Subcellular location | Cytoplasm. Nucleus. Note: Nuclear in interphase, nuclear during mitosis. |
| Tissue specificity | Isoform Delta-2 is widely expressed. Isoform Delta-1 is highly expressed in brain. |
| Induction | By retinoic acid; in neuroblastoma cell lines. |
| Post-translational modification | Phosphorylated upon DNA damage, probably by ATM or ATR. Ref.10 Ref.11 Ref.12 Ref.13 |
| Sequence similarities | Belongs to the phosphatase 2A regulatory subunit B56 family. |

Alternative products
| This entry describes 3 isoforms produced by alternative splicing. [Align] [Select] | ||||||
| Isoform Delta-1 (identifier: Q14738-1) This isoform has been chosen as the 'canonical' sequence. All positional information in this entry refers to it. This is also the sequence that appears in the downloadable versions of the entry. | ||||||
| Isoform Delta-2 (identifier: Q14738-2) The sequence of this isoform differs from the canonical sequence as follows: 85-116: Missing. | ||||||
| Isoform Delta-3 (identifier: Q14738-3) The sequence of this isoform differs from the canonical sequence as follows: 11-116: Missing. |
